The multi-planet system TOI-5624: Four transiting sub-Neptunes with an outer companion revealed by transit-timing variations
Four transiting sub-Neptunes with radii measured to <1.7% precision and masses >3 sigma for three planets, plus an outer non-transiting companion, discovered around TOI-5624 via TESS, CHEOPS photometry, and ground-based RV data.

An Ultra-Short Period Super-Earth and a Sub-Neptune Orbiting the K dwarf TOI-4311
TOI-4311 hosts a 0.99-day super-Earth (1.38 R_earth, 4.5 M_earth) and 15-day sub-Neptune (2.47 R_earth), plus a candidate 38-day planet, with the dense inner planet potentially challenging formation theories given the host's galactic population.
